RAMALLAH, Friday, September 1, 2023 (WAFA) – Hot to extremely hot weather conditions are expected today in Palestine despite a slight drop in temperatures, which still remain approximately 3°C above the seasonal average, according to the Palestine Meteorological Department.

Winds are southwesterly to northwesterly, moderate to active, and the sea waves are low.

Temperature in the capital, Jerusalem, and Bethlehem is expected to reach a high of 31°C and a low of 18°C, and in Ramallah and Hebron a high of 30°C and a low of 17°C. In Jericho, the Dead Sea, and the Jordan Valley temperature is expected to reach a high of 40°C and a low of 24°C, while it is expected to reach a high of 30°C and a low of 23°C in Gaza and the coastal areas.

Weather on Saturday is predicted to be a typical summer day with another slight drop in temperatures, setting back to their seasonal average.  

Sunday is also expected to be a typical summer day with little change in temperatures, remaining around the seasonal average.  

On Monday, temperatures are expected to rise to relatively hot conditions, with an increase of about 6°C above the seasonal average.  

The Meteorological Department has issued a warning to people about the risk of prolonged exposure to direct sunlight, especially during peak hours, and the danger of starting fires in areas with dry grass.
